Output 3ebc2e524120932b177f4c28d4521cb1c62fb7777e9dae1578d76d6f06de33dd:0

value
3362676279
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3c74d25d30e56b3df7d348320094f6e5d4388fc OP_EQUALVERIFY OP_CHECKSIG
address
LbcXyFZLBQFA8PD8awUDC1aae4t85c9hUM
transaction
3ebc2e524120932b177f4c28d4521cb1c62fb7777e9dae1578d76d6f06de33dd
spent
true